Carbon steel flanges are fittings used in pipelines to connect various components. They are made from carbon steel, which is a type of steel that contains varying amounts of carbon, enhancing its strength and hardness. These flanges offer various advantages and are commonly used in various applications.

Stainless steel flanges, on the other hand, are made from a type of steel that contains at least 10.5% chromium. This addition provides excellent corrosion resistance, making these flanges suitable for environments where moisture or chemicals might be present.
Carbon steel flanges do not have the same level of corrosion resistance as stainless steel flanges. This makes stainless steel flanges a better choice for applications where exposure to moisture or chemical agents is likely.
Carbon steel flanges are typically stronger and harder than stainless steel flanges. This makes them suitable for high-load situations in industrial applications.
Generally, carbon steel flanges are less expensive than stainless steel flanges. This can be a significant factor for projects with budget constraints.
Carbon steel is denser than stainless steel, resulting in carbon steel flanges being heavier. Depending on the application, this can be a crucial consideration.
Carbon steel flanges are commonly used in oil and gas industries, while stainless steel flanges are often found in food processing, pharmaceuticals, and seawater systems due to their corrosion resistance.
The choice between carbon steel flanges and stainless steel flanges depends largely on the application requirements. Consider the following factors:
If the application involves exposure to corrosive materials or environments, stainless steel flanges may be more suitable.
If cost is a primary concern, carbon steel flanges may provide a more economical solution.
For applications requiring higher strength and load-bearing capacity, carbon steel flanges might be the best choice.
To ensure longevity and reliable performance, carbon steel flanges should be regularly inspected for signs of corrosion or damage, especially if they are used in environments with moisture. Proper coating or painting can also help in preventing rust.
